Recorded live at his June 1st Cavern gig, Rennie expands on the formula he first utilised over four years ago for Perfecto, when he recorded the first ever Ableton Live mix album. Incorporating live keyboards, samples and MCing, Rennie uses the experience he has gained with his TCR Allstars Band (one of the ‘20 Live Dance Acts You Must See’ according to DJ Mag) to deliver a CD, which perfectly captures the unique atmosphere of a Beatz & Bobz night.
Opening with his own ‘Nu Era’, Rennie takes listeners on a journey through the bass-driven dancefloor stomp of DJ Icey’s ‘Gonzo Fuse’, taking in the reggae-tinged funk of ‘Babylon Breaks’ by Ed Solo & Skool Of Thought, Uberzone’s future classic ‘Satisfaction’ and the old school electro sampling ‘Hyperspeed’ by the Drumattic Twins’.
